For instance, if your league has an innings cap, you want to make sure you use up all of your innings. In Yahoo’s game, you can actually go over the cap if you plan correctly. As the final day of the season gets close, do your best to run your innings up to just below the cap. Then, on the day of the last games, every single pitching slot should have an active pitcher in there. The Yahoo game will allow all of the innings pitched on that final day to be credited to your team. Of course, this also applies to strikeouts, wins, saves and holds (if your league uses them).

In addition to maximizing your pitching, you should also make sure all of your hitters are active for you every day. Be careful and watch out for veteran players getting time off, especially if their team has clinched a playoff spot. Don’t get enamored with last minute rookie call ups and players that might be on the waiver wire. Most of the time you are much better off with the hitters that got you to this point, as opposed to a rookie getting his first at bats in the Majors. In other words, stick with the players that got you to the dance in the first place.

The table below will be published each week showing the expected pitching rotation matchups, whether the game is at home or on the road, and it will include the pitcher’s handedness (left-handers are designated with an “L”). Finally, you will note that each matchup is assigned a ranking numbered #1-5. This number refers to my recommendation as far as starting that pitcher in Fantasy play and the rankings break down as follows:

1 – Must-Start – These pitchers are aces and are virtually matchup proof.

2 – Favorable Start – These pitchers may or may not be aces but the matchup is favorable.

3 – Streaming Option – These pitchers are in a favorable matchup, so they can be started if needed.

4 – Risky Start – The matchup is prohibitively risky. Owners are advised to avoid this pitcher.

5 – Bench – Do not start this pitcher in this matchup.
